I'll be taking this Christmas off again but I haven't made the decision because I don't want to make the chocolate but I've also based it on costs because my old pricing of ยฃ2.50 per 80g bar would have to increase to a huge ยฃ4.00 per bar, I question whether anyone would buy chocolate bars costing that much.
And if no one did I'd be left with alot of stock.
There's alot of work that goes into my products from the ingredients labels to making I don't currently have the 7+ hrs a day I'd spend at Christmas season to spare I have about 2hrs. Which is alot less.
I hope you all understand but also on the other hand if you would pay ยฃ4 for a chocolate bar from us let us know because it would be interesting.
